#f63bfa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f63bfa is composed of 96.5% red, 23.1%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 298.7 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 60.6%. #f63bfa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#ed00f5.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#f63bfa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f63bfa has RGB values of R:246, G:59,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16137210.

Shades and Tints of #f63bfa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000e is the darkest color, while #fffaff is the lightest one.
